[Asia Economy Reporter Jongil Park] Dongjin Lee, Mayor of Dobong-gu, conducted an on-site inspection on the 15th of the renovation and installation works around Nokcheon Bridge on Jungnangcheon Stream, including the water play area and basketball court.
Dobong-gu has newly refurbished the water play area, rest plaza, basketball court, and jokgu court around Nokcheon Bridge on Jungnangcheon Stream, which had not been properly maintained due to the expansion construction of the Dongbu Expressway. In addition, the bicycle paths and walking trails were rearranged to eliminate inconveniences for existing residents.
After touring the site, Mayor Dongjin Lee of Dobong-gu said, “Since the water play facilities are mostly used by children, special attention must be paid to water quality management and safety.” He added, “In preparation for the sharp increase in residents’ use during the summer, please provide changing rooms and restrooms to ensure convenience.”
He also emphasized, “Please pay attention to the inspection and placement of disinfectants for the living sports facilities set up along Jungnangcheon Stream in accordance with COVID-19 quarantine measures.”
